Safety precautions
5
•  Leave some slack in the cord of the earphones if you wind them around the unit.
• Do not disassemble, remodel, drop, or allow the unit to get wet.
•  Do not use or store in locations directly exposed to sunlight, corrosive gases, a 
heat vent, or a heating appliance.
• Do not use or store in humid or dusty locations.
• Do not use force to open the battery lid.
•  Do not play your headphones or earphones at a high volume. Hearing experts 
advise against continuous extended play.
•  Do not use while operating a motorized vehicle. It may create a traffic hazard 
and is illegal in many areas.
Batteries
• Align the poles (+ and –) properly when inserting the battery.
• Do not recharge ordinary dry cell battery.
• Remove the battery if the unit is not to be used for a long time.
• Do not use batteries if the covering has been peeled off.
•  Mishandling of battery can cause electrolyte leakage which can damage items 
the fluid contacts and may cause a fire.
  If electrolyte leaks from the batteries, consult your dealer.
   Wash thoroughly with water if electrolyte comes in contact with any part of your 
body.
•  If electrolyte gets into your eyes, you may lose your sight. Do not rub your eyes but wash 
them with clean water, and seek medical advice immediately.
•  Do not throw into fire, short-circuit, disassemble, or subject to excessive heat.
Allergies
Discontinue use if you experience discomfort with the earphones or any other 
parts that directly contact your skin. Continued use may cause rashes or other 
allergic reactions.
